Logo
  • Cases & Projects
  • Developers
  • Contact
Sign InSign Up

Here you can add a description about your company or product

© Copyright 2025 Makerkit. All Rights Reserved.

Product
  • Cases & Projects
  • Developers
About
  • Contact
Legal
  • Terms of Service
  • Privacy Policy
  • Cookie Policy
Development of an Advanced Cross-Device Push Notification Platform for Enhanced Customer Engagement
  1. case
  2. Development of an Advanced Cross-Device Push Notification Platform for Enhanced Customer Engagement

Development of an Advanced Cross-Device Push Notification Platform for Enhanced Customer Engagement

ahex.co
Advertising & marketing
eCommerce
Business services

Identifying Key Challenges in Customer Engagement and Campaign Management

The client faces difficulties in efficiently engaging customers across multiple devices and browsers, managing complex audience segmentation, recovering lost revenue from cart abandonment, and measuring campaign performance in real-time. They require a scalable, multi-tenant platform that supports targeted, triggered, and scheduled notifications, along with detailed analytics to optimize marketing efforts.

About the Client

A mid-to-large sized digital marketing agency seeking a comprehensive push notification system to improve client campaign effectiveness, customer segmentation, and analytics capabilities.

Goals for Building a Robust Customer Engagement and Notification System

  • Develop a scalable web and mobile application enabling advanced customer segmentation based on behavioral and demographic data.
  • Implement automated cart recovery notifications to maximize revenue recovery.
  • Enable multiuser and multisite management through a centralized control system with configurable user roles.
  • Support triggered and scheduled push notification campaigns tailored by behavior, time zones, and user segments.
  • Provide comprehensive analytics dashboards to track campaign performance, clickthrough rates, and engagement metrics in real-time.
  • Ensure crossbrowser and crossdevice compatibility to maximize reach and engagement.
  • Build a secure, high-performance platform capable of handling a large volume of notifications.

Core Functional Features for the Notification Management System

  • Audience segmentation based on behavioral patterns and demographic data using predefined logic.
  • Automated cart recovery notifications triggered by cart abandonment events.
  • Multiuser and multisite management allowing centralized control with role-based access.
  • Behavior-based triggered campaigns to enhance engagement and conversions.
  • Scheduling capabilities for campaigns to be sent at specific dates, times, and time zones.
  • Real-time analytics dashboard providing data on opt-ins, campaign performance, clickthrough rates, and overall results.

Recommended Technologies and Architectural Patterns

Frontend: HTML, CSS, Bootstrap, Angular, Sass, Gulp
Backend: Laravel, Node.js (Express), MySQL, MongoDB, Redis, socket.io, service worker
Hosting/Deployment: Cloud platforms such as AWS Elastic Beanstalk

Necessary External System Integrations

  • Email service providers for sending notifications
  • Analytics tools for performance measurement
  • Authentication and role management systems

Important Non-Functional System Requirements

  • High scalability to manage a large volume of push notifications
  • Cross-browser and cross-device compatibility
  • Real-time delivery with minimal latency
  • Robust security measures for data protection and user privacy
  • Ability to handle multiple sites and users efficiently

Projected Business Benefits and Success Metrics

Implementing this notification platform is expected to significantly increase customer engagement rates, improve conversion and revenue recovery from cart abandonment, and provide detailed insights for campaign optimization. The scalable, multi-tenant solution aims to handle a large volume of notifications reliably and efficiently, ultimately enhancing the client's marketing effectiveness and client satisfaction.

More from this Company

Staff Augmentation and Rapid Team Scaling for IT Service Projects
Development of a Secure Cryptocurrency Trading Platform with Scalable Web & Mobile Interfaces
UI Development for Custom Digital Platform with Responsive Design and Seamless Integration
Development of a Scalable Mentoring and Consulting Platform with Real-Time Communication and Analytics
Integrated Retail Software Solution for Manufacturing & Textile Industry